Test results

Blood tests requested by one of our clinicians are usually done by a phlebotomist at Deeside Community Hospital.

To book an appointment with a phlebotomist for your blood tests, please phone 03000 850047 English line, between 9am and 4pm, Monday to Friday. Alternatively, please email BCU.BloodTests@wales.nhs.uk to book an appointment.

Please note, if you have a time specific blood test request e.g. high risks drugs monitoring bloods or INR and you are unable to get phlebotomy appointment in the specified time, please let us know.

Getting your test results

It is the responsibility of the patient to contact the surgery for their results following any form of investigation i.e blood tests or x-ray results.

All your results we requested are reviewed by a clinician and we may contact you if necessary.

If your test results show that you need more tests or treatment, we will contact you.
